Sausage & Bacon Baked Mac and Cheese

  • 1 package Smoked Sausage
  • 2 cups uncooked macaroni (about 8 ounces)
  • 1 tablespoon butter or margarine
  • 3 tablespoons all purpose flour
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 2 1/2 cup milk
  • 1 cup (4 ounces) shredded white or sharp C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up (4 ounces) shredded Monterrey Jack cheese
  • 6 slices bacon, cooked, crumbled, divided
  • 4 green onions, sliced
  1. Preheat oven to 350F. Cut sausage into 1/2" cubes. Add sausage to a large skillet; cook and stir over medium heat for 3-4 minutes or until sausage is lightly browned. Remove sausage from skillet; keep warm.
  2. Cook macaroni according to package directions. Drain, rinse and keep warm.
  3. Melt butter in large saucepan over medium heat. Stir in flour, salt and pepper. Stir in milk. Cook and stir until thickened and bubbly. Cook and stir for 1 minute more. Stir in cheese, 4 slices of the bacon and green onion stirring until cheese melted.
  4. Stir in sausage and cooked macaroni. Pour mixture into a greased 2-quart baking dish. Sprinkle with remaining bacon. Bake 20-25 minutes or until edges are bubbling.
